BET Awards 2022: 5 of Wizkid’s Hottest U.S. Collaborations

What’s your favorite track from the Nigerian Afrobeats star?

Afrobeats star Wizkid is steadily on the path to becoming an international pop star. After establishing himself as a prominent entertainer in his native home of Nigeria, a career filled with record-breaking moments, the “Essence” singer is ready to take on America. He’s already off to a successful start having teamed up with some of the biggest names in the music industry, including Grammy Award-winning rapper Drake and singer Justin Bieber. He’s also received several awards and nominations, including a “Best International Artist” nom at the BET Awards 2021.

  • “Come Closer” feat. Drake

    Wizkid teamed up with Canadian hip hop star Drake for this uptempo 2016 release from the Nigerian singer’s third studio album, Sounds from the Other Side, making him the second African artist to be certified Gold after Davido.

  • “Essence” feat. Justin Bieber and Tems

    After the release of his 2021 smash hit “Essence” featuring fellow Nigerian singer Tems. Following the song’s massive success, including a nomination at the 64th  Annual Grammy Awards for “Best Global Music Performance,” he teamed up with Grammy Award-winning singer-songwriter Justin Beiber for a remix.

  • Drake “One Dance” feat. Wizkid

    While Wizkid celebrated the success of his Drake-assisted single “Come Closer,” he also enjoyed the fruits of another collaboration with the Canadian rapper. Released simultaneously, “One Dance” peaked at number one on the US Billboard Hot 100 and marked his most successful mainstream record.

  • “Smile” feat. H.E.R.

    Wizkid teamed up with singer-songwriter H.E.R. for a song celebrating life and his three children. The song even made its way onto former President Barack Obama’s 2020 summer playlist.

  • Justine Skye - “U Don't Know “feat. Wizkid

    Up-and-coming R&B and pop singer Justine Skye enlisted Wizkid for this uptempo track title “U Don’t Know ” of her debut album Ultraviolet.
